In today's world, data plays a crucial role in decision-making processes across various sectors. One term that frequently arises in discussions about finances and project management is the estimated amount. This phrase refers to a calculated approximation of a quantity, often related to costs, resources, or time needed to complete a task or project. Understanding the concept of estimated amount is essential for effective planning and execution.For instance, consider a construction project. Before breaking ground, project managers must assess the estimated amount of materials required to build a structure. This includes calculating the total volume of concrete, the number of bricks, and the amount of steel needed. If the estimated amount is inaccurate, it can lead to significant delays and budget overruns. Therefore, obtaining an accurate estimated amount is crucial for the smooth progression of the project.Moreover, businesses often rely on the estimated amount when creating budgets. For example, a company planning to launch a new product will need to estimate the costs associated with production, marketing, and distribution. The estimated amount helps the company allocate resources effectively and set realistic sales targets. If the estimated amount is too low, the company may face financial difficulties; if it is too high, it may deter investors.Furthermore, the concept of estimated amount extends beyond finances. In scientific research, researchers often provide an estimated amount of time needed to complete experiments or studies. This estimation helps in scheduling and allocating resources efficiently. A well-prepared research proposal will include an estimated amount of time and funding required to achieve the desired results, which is critical for securing grants and approvals.The accuracy of the estimated amount can depend on several factors, including the availability of data, historical precedents, and expert judgment. It is important to gather as much relevant information as possible to make informed estimates. For example, historical data from previous projects can provide valuable insights into what the estimated amount should be based on similar circumstances.In conclusion, the term estimated amount encapsulates a fundamental aspect of planning and resource management in various fields. Whether in construction, business, or research, understanding and accurately determining the estimated amount is vital for success. As we continue to navigate complex projects and financial landscapes, the ability to make precise estimations will remain a key skill for professionals across industries. Therefore, enhancing our understanding of how to calculate and utilize the estimated amount can lead to more efficient and effective outcomes in our endeavors.
